迁移后的系统优化
## 迁移后的系统优化:策略、挑战与最佳实践
随着企业业务的不断扩展和技术的持续进步,系统迁移已成为许多组织面临的关键任务。系统迁移不仅涉及将数据从一个系统转移到另一个系统,还包括对现有系统的优化,以确保新系统能够高效、稳定地运行,并满足业务需求。本文将探讨迁移后的系统优化策略,面临的挑战以及最佳实践。
### 一、迁移后的系统优化策略
**1. 数据迁移与校验**
数据迁移是系统迁移过程中至关重要的一环。在迁移过程中,必须确保数据的完整性和准确性。首先,需要制定详细的数据迁移计划,包括数据备份、迁移时间表、资源分配等。其次,在迁移过程中,应对数据进行实时校验,确保数据的一致性。对于关键数据,可以采用双写或备份恢复的方式进行额外保护。
**2. 性能调优**
新系统上线后,可能需要进行一系列的性能调优工作。这包括数据库优化、服务器配置调整、网络带宽升级等。例如,可以通过优化查询语句、增加索引、分区表等方式提高数据库性能;通过调整服务器参数、部署负载均衡等方式提升服务器的处理能力;通过升级网络设备、优化网络架构等方式增强网络传输速度。
**3. 安全策略更新**
系统迁移后,安全策略也需要进行相应的更新。这包括用户权限管理、访问控制列表(ACL)的更新、加密算法的升级等。为了防止潜在的安全风险,需要对系统进行全面的安全漏洞扫描,并及时修复发现的漏洞。此外,还应加强员工的安全意识培训,提高整个组织的安全防护水平。
**4. 应用程序兼容性测试**
在系统迁移后,需要对应用程序进行全面的兼容性测试。这包括功能测试、性能测试、安全测试等。通过测试,可以发现并解决应用程序在新环境中存在的问题,确保应用程序在新系统中能够正常运行。
### 二、迁移过程中面临的挑战
**1. 技术复杂性**
系统迁移涉及多个技术领域,包括数据库管理、网络通信、服务器配置等。这些技术之间的交互和协同可能导致迁移过程的复杂性和不确定性。此外,新技术和新方法的不断涌现也给系统迁移带来了更大的挑战。
**2. 数据迁移风险**
数据迁移过程中可能出现数据丢失、数据损坏、数据不一致等问题。这些问题不仅影响业务的正常运行,还可能给企业带来巨大的经济损失。因此,在数据迁移过程中,必须采取有效的风险防范措施。
**3. 业务连续性保障**
系统迁移可能导致业务中断,影响企业的正常运营。为了保障业务连续性,需要在迁移前制定详细的业务连续性计划,包括应急预案、资源保障等。
### 三、系统迁移后的最佳实践
**1. 制定详细的迁移计划**
在系统迁移前,应制定详细的迁移计划,包括迁移目标、迁移步骤、资源需求、风险评估等。迁移计划应具有可操作性和可监控性,以便在迁移过程中及时发现问题并进行调整。
**2. 强化项目管理**
系统迁移是一项复杂的系统工程,需要强有力的项目管理支持。应建立明确的项目管理团队,负责迁移过程中的进度控制、质量管理和风险管理等工作。
**3. 持续监控与优化**
系统迁移后,应持续对新系统进行监控和优化。通过收集用户反馈和数据分析,及时发现并解决系统存在的问题,不断提升系统的性能和稳定性。
总之,系统迁移后的系统优化是一个复杂而重要的过程。通过制定合理的优化策略、积极应对迁移过程中的挑战以及遵循最佳实践,企业可以确保新系统的高效、稳定和安全运行,从而为企业的长远发展奠定坚实的基础。